ABSTRACT:
In an optical element, and a method and apparatus for forming the same, peeling does not occur while a resin layer is cured, and the completed optical element can be easily released after the resin layer has been completely cured. The optical-element forming apparatus includes a forming surface for transferring a predetermined surface shape onto a surface of the resin layer, and includes a mold member having a high molecular weight material satisfying physical values of a hardness: >D50 and/or >R70, a modulus of elasticity: 5000-35000 kgf/cm.sup.2, a coefficient of friction: <0.2, a coefficient of water absorption: <0.3%, and a light resistance: invariable or slightly variable.
